O2Micro Reports Second Quarter 2014 Financial Results


GEORGE TOWN, Grand Cayman, July 23, 2014 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) –

Operational and Strategic Highlights:

  • Company experienced strong design activity in backlighting solutions for smartphone and tablet markets; shipping novel design to major smartphone customer
     
  • Quarterly revenue increased six percent sequentially
     
  • 1H14 operating expenses reduced by $5.0 million from year-ago period

O2Micro® International Limited (Nasdaq:OIIM), a global leader in the design, development and marketing of high-performance integrated circuits and solutions, reported its financial results today for the second quarter of 2014, ending June 30, 2014.

Financial Highlights for the Second Quarter ending June 30, 2014:

O2Micro International Limited reported Q2 2014 revenue of $17.4 million. Revenue was up 6% sequentially and down 7% from the comparable year-ago quarter. The gross margin in the second quarter of 2014 was 51.5%. The gross margin was flat from the prior quarter and up from 51.2% in the second quarter of 2013. The gross margin remains in our target range and varies primarily with revenue level and product mix. During the second quarter of 2014, the company recorded total GAAP operating expenses of $12.1 million, compared to $11.6 million in the first quarter of 2014 and $14.6 million in the year-ago Q2 period. The respective GAAP operating margins for the second quarter of 2014, the first quarter of 2014, and second quarter of 2013 were (17.9%), (18.9%), and (26.8%).

GAAP net loss was $3.2 million in Q2 2014. This compares to a GAAP net loss of $2.9 million in the first quarter of 2014 and a GAAP net loss of $4.4 million in Q2 2013. GAAP net loss per fully diluted ADS was $0.12 in Q2 2014. This compares to a GAAP net loss per fully diluted ADS of $0.10 in Q1 2014 and a GAAP net loss per fully diluted ADS of $0.15 in Q2 2013.

Financial Highlights for the Six Months ending June 30, 2014:

O2Micro International Limited reported revenue of $33.9 million for the six months ending June 30, 2014. This was down 6.1% from $36.1 million in the comparable six months of 2013. The gross margins were 51.5% and 50.6% during the corresponding periods of 2014 and 2013, respectively. GAAP operating expenses were $23.7 million and $28.7 million in the first half of 2014 and 2013, respectively. The respective GAAP operating margins for the comparable periods were (18.4%) and (29.0%). Pretax loss from continuing operations was $5.6 million in the first half of 2014. This compares to a pretax loss from continuing operations of $9.0 million in the first half of 2013. GAAP net loss was $6.1 million in 1H 2014. This compares to a GAAP net loss of $9.5 million in 1H 2013. The GAAP net loss per fully diluted ADS was $0.22 in the first six months of 2014. This compares to a GAAP net loss per fully diluted ADS of $0.32 in the corresponding first half of 2013.

Supplementary Data:

The company ended the second quarter of 2014 with $66.2 million in unrestricted cash and short-term investments or $2.42 per outstanding ADS. The accounts receivable balance was $10.2 million and represented 47 days sales outstanding at the end of Q2 2014. Inventory was $9.6 million or 95 days and turned over 3.8 times during Q2 2014. As of June 30, 2014, the company had $77.8 million in working capital and the book value was $118.8 million, or $4.35 per outstanding ADS.

As of June 30, 2014, O2Micro International Limited counted 475 employees, including 281 engineers.

About O2Micro

Founded in April 1995, O2Micro develops and markets innovative power management components for the Computer, Consumer, Industrial, Automotive and Communications markets. Products include LED General Lighting, Backlighting, Battery Management and Power Management.
